According to the World Steel Association (worldsteel), Turkey produced about 3.2 million tons of crude steel in May, down 5.9% from the previous month and down 1.14% from the same month last year. .
In total, Turkey produced about 16 million tons of crude steel in the first five months of 2022, down 2.8% from the same period a year earlier.
Energy prices in Turkey have been raised since June 1 and are expected to rise in July, coupled with a slowdown in the market, which could lead to further declines in crude steel production in the coming months.
